Key Market Indicators
Production of garlic in Madagascar is set to rise to around 3,350 metric tons by 2026. This would represent an average annual growth rate of 1.4% since 2021, when the country produced 3,090 metric tons. Since 1966, Malagasy garlic production has grown at a rate of 1.8% a year. In 2021, it was placed 54th in the world rankings, overtaken by Lebanon at 3,090 metric tons. India, Bangladesh and South Korea were ranked 2nd, 3rd and 4th respectively.
